Output e0209684c357e362dcfbfa69ec243f9d44f7a8aa4d3cc54c88f01b377028371f:10

value
369513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374200ed3324e755800bade289548113adcf6 OP_EQUAL
address
3BMEX93tq146LknyGeZdjcbAmDiEgTY3eP
transaction
e0209684c357e362dcfbfa69ec243f9d44f7a8aa4d3cc54c88f01b377028371f
spent
true